Directive and Non-directive Counseling
Directive Counseling tends to be appropriate when the counselor is aware of the problem and/or is concerned about the behaviour of the patient but the latter is unaware about the problem and is avoiding acknowledging it. In contrast, tzon-directive coulselinig is more appropriate when the patient or the counselce has insight and says that the counselor's help is needed to solve the problem.
